Notes and sketches in brown and blue pen made while Barry Flanagan was in Ibiza, Majorca and Madrid, Spain
Drawings of a Barry’s daughter Annabelle asleep as a child. Drawings of seascapes and townscapses. Child’s drawing. Portrait of a woman wearing a head scarf. Drawings of a hollow female torso related to untitled 79 (1979). Morphological drawings linked to Hare works; one with the base and treble clef motif.
Note to Leslie Waddington of Waddington Galleries, London, UK. Two flyers for lecture to be given by Flanagan at Jesus College, Cambridge, UK on 8 March 1992. Lists of names and addresses, otherwise bank notebook.
